Official abstract text for this publication.
A unit has at least one light emitting diode (LED), a light-guiding lens in front of the LED, a downwardly inclined transparent window disposed in front of the light guiding lens, and light-shielding coatings disposed on a surface of the transparent window facing the light guiding lens, above and below the front face of the light-guiding lens. The light-guiding lens includes a light incident portion; a first reflecting surface for upwardly reflecting light from an upper half of the light incident portion; second reflecting surfaces for laterally reflecting light from a lower half of the light incident portion; third reflecting surfaces for upwardly reflecting light from the second reflecting surfaces; a fourth reflecting surface for forwardly reflecting the light from the first and third reflecting surfaces; and a light exiting surface for projecting light from the fourth reflecting surface forward.

What is claimed is: 1. A lighting unit configured to be mounted on a vehicle having a body defining a front-to-rear direction, the unit comprising: a light source having an optical axis extending forward along the front-to-rear direction; a light-guiding lens disposed in front of the light source; a transparent plate disposed in front of the light-guiding lens, the transparent plate being inclined so as to be closer to the light-guiding lens toward one side of a first direction orthogonal to the front-to-rear direction; and light-shielding members disposed on the transparent plate at respective sides of a portion in the first orthogonal direction in front of a front surface of the light-guiding lens when viewed from its front side, wherein the light-guiding lens includes: a light incident portion facing the light source, the light incident portion receiving light emitted from the light source and redirecting such light to be substantially parallel to the front-to-rear direction; a first reflecting surface provided forward of a first half of the light incident portion on a first side of the first orthogonal direction, so that the first reflecting surface internally reflects the light incident on the first half of the light incident portion to the first side of the first orthogonal direction; a second reflecting surface provided forward of a second half of the light incident portion on a second side of the first orthogonal direction, so that the second reflecting surface internally reflects the light incident on the second half of the light incident portion in a second orthogonal direction orthogonal to both the first orthogonal direction and the front-to-rear direction; a third reflecting surface provided in the second orthogonal direction with respect to the second reflecting surface, so that the third reflecting surface reflects the light internally reflected by the second reflecting surface to the first side of the first orthogonal direction a fourth reflecting surface provided in the first side of the first orthogonal direction with respect to the first reflecting surface and the third reflecting surface, so that the fourth reflecting surface internally reflect the light internally reflected by the first reflecting surface and the third reflecting surface forward; and a light exiting surface provided on the first side of the first orthogonal direction on the front surface of the light-guiding lens and in front of the fourth reflecting surface, so that the light exiting surface projects the light internally reflected by the fourth reflecting surface forward. 2. The vehicle lighting unit according to claim 1 , wherein: the first orthogonal direction is a vertical direction and the first side of the first orthogonal direction is an upper side; and the second orthogonal direction is a horizontal direction. 3. The vehicle lighting unit according to claim 2 , wherein: the vehicle lighting unit is applied to a high-mount stop lamp, which projects light rearward of the vehicle body; and the transparent plate is a car window provided on a rear side of the vehicle body. 4. The vehicle lighting unit according to claim 1 , wherein: the second reflecting surface includes two second reflecting surfaces to internally reflect the light having been incident on the second half of the light incident portion to both sides of the second orthogonal direction; and the third reflecting surface includes two third reflecting surfaces provided on both sides of the second orthogonal direction corresponding to the two second reflecting surfaces, respectively. 5. The vehicle lighting unit according to claim 4 , wherein: the first orthogonal direction is a vertical direction and the first side of the first orthogonal direction is an upper side; and the second orthogonal direction is a horizontal direction. 6. The vehicle lighting unit according to claim 5 , wherein: the vehicle lighting unit is applied to a high-mount stop lamp, which projects light rearward of the vehicle body; and the transparent plate is a car window provided on a rear side of the vehicle body.
